extract TUI Model god class into focused sub-controllers
Split the 1389-line tui.go Model into three focused sub-controllers that each own a single concern: - filterstack.go (filterStack): owns the filter chain, undo history, and label stack; provides push/pop/rebindProcessFilters API so the Model never manipulates filter slices directly. - tracelifecycle.go (traceLifecycle): owns trace start/stop and the active context.CancelFunc; provides beginCmd/stop API; also houses the recorder helpers (recorderStart/Stop/Active/Status) and the auto-reset cycle logic (nextAutoResetInterval, autoResetCycle). - screenrouter.go (screenRouter): owns the picker-return bookmark (pickerReturn) and the applyWindowSizeToPicker helper so screen transition code in tui.go delegates to it. The Model.Update switch is split into dispatchTypedMsg (framework messages) and dispatchAppMsg (app messages) to keep each helper under the 50-line limit. View is split into viewPickerScreen and viewDashboardScreen for the same reason. All functions are ≤50 lines. go test ./internal/tui/... passes.
